CLEVELAND, Ohio - Kaylee Neumeister, who led Lakeview HS to a state title this year, has signed a National Letter of Intent to attend Cleveland State University.
Neumeister will join the program in the fall of 2016 and have four years of eligibility.
A four-time first team All-Northeast Ohio selection, Neumeister was the conference tournament medalist as a sophomore and junior and was the conference Player of the Year as a sophomore. She was the No. 1 player all four year, leading the team to a seventh place finish in the state her sophomore year, a runner-up finish at the state tournament as a junior and the state title her senior year.
At this year's state tournament, Neumeister shot 75-78 (153) and finished as the individual runner-up, earning first team all-state honors. She also finished as the runner-up at the district tournament.
That came on the heels of Neumeister finishing ninth in the state tournament as a junior with rounds of 79-77 (156) and earning second team all-state accolades.
She finished 11th at the state tournament as a sophomore.
Neumeister lowered her scoring average all four year, culminating with a 37.8 scoring average this year.
A member of the National Honor Society and a three-year Academic letterwinner, Neumeister plans to major in chemical engineering at CSU.
